Pity is the count of wishes since your last 5★. Soft pity (from 74 in Genshin) is when the 5★ chance starts rising a lot each wish. Hard pity (90) is the cap where a 5★ is guaranteed. The calculator accounts for all three.

In Genshin Impact, each wish has a low chance of giving a 5★ character (0.6% base rate), but from wish 74 (soft pity) that chance climbs fast every attempt, up to wish 90, where the 5★ is guaranteed (hard pity). When you get a 5★, the 50/50 decides whether it is the banner's featured character or a standard one, and if you lose the 50/50, your next 5★ is the guaranteed featured. Before version 5.0, losing the 50/50 meant waiting up to 90 more wishes for the featured character, with no extra help the first time it happened. Capturing Radiance changed that: it can grant the featured character even on a lost 50/50, and the more times in a row you lose, the higher the chance of that happening, up to a point where HoYoverse guarantees you won't lose that many times in a row.
HoYoverse confirmed the mechanic exists and that it does not touch your pity or the guarantees you already have, but it has never published the full formula for the percentages. Community estimates (from datamining and large samples of pulls) suggest a rising chance with each consecutive loss, but the exact numbers vary from source to source. Because of that, this calculator shows the chance without Capturing Radiance: a safe floor, since the real chance tends to be equal or better.
The weapon banner has a 5★ base rate of 0.7%, slightly higher than the character banner's 0.6%, with soft pity starting at wish 63 and guaranteed hard pity at wish 80.
Instead of the 50/50, the weapon banner uses the Epitomized Path: you pick a weapon from the list before pulling and gain one Fervent Fervor point for every 5★ that isn't the one you picked. At 2 points, meaning after two hard pities in a row without your chosen weapon, the next 5★ is guaranteed to be the weapon you marked.
